Le Roman au Temps de Shakespeare, by Jean Jules Jusserand, offers a detailed exploration of the novel during Shakespeare’s time. Written in French, this historical study examines the development of prose fiction in England, providing valuable insights into the literary landscape of the Elizabethan era. Jusserand delves into the cultural and social contexts that shaped the novels of the period, highlighting their unique characteristics and significance. This work remains a key resource for scholars of English literature and those interested in the history of the novel.
